php怎么跨会话存取session php严格区分大小写是错的还是对的?
php严格区分大小写是错的还是对的?
区分字母大小写标准:
session_start()
$_SESSION[name]value;
应该是PHP把
$_Session[views]1;
当成数组了
asp中session如何定期清空?
这个是在文件中配置好的,apache或以外服务器自动扫描的,不不需要你写程序确认。也可以直接修改后面的值直接修改session快到期时长
PHP如何避免表单的重复提交?
1.不使用JS让按钮在再点一次后禁用(disable)。按结构这样的方法可以防止两次然后点击的发生,基于较简单的。缺点是若客户端禁止打开JavaScript脚本,则无法激活。
2.在递交完成后不能执行页面重定向(redirect)。转回递交成功信息页面。特点:以免F5重复一遍并提交,除掉浏览器快速前进和退后设置按钮可造成的虽然问题。
3.表单追踪域中储存时session(表单被请求时能生成的标记)。采用此方法在可以接收表单数据后,系统检查此标志值如何确定存在地,先参与删掉,然后把处理数据若不存在,说明已提交过,忽略第二环节提交。
4.数据库同样索引强制力(最有效的避兔再重复一遍数据的方法)。
5.不使用验证码
Session和Cookie是什么关系?
1、cookie数据贮存在客户的浏览器上,session数据放到服务器上。
2、cookie不是什么很放心,别人也可以讲贮放在本地的cookie并接受cookie欺骗,考虑到到安全应当及时在用session。
3、session会在一定时间内存放在服务器上。当ftp连接逐渐减少,会比较好占用带宽你服务器的性能,考虑到到缓解服务器性能方面,应当使用cookie。
4、单个cookie能保存的数据又不能达到4K,很多浏览器都限制下载两个站点最多保存20个cookie。
5、可以判断将登陆后信息等有用信息贮放为session,其他信息如果不是必须保留,这个可以放进cookie中。
Session和Cookie的关系唯有1点:PHP关闭Session后会将用户标识也记录到客户端COOKIE中存放
而现在的浏览器自身的SESSION,与COOKIE无关系,在浏览器关掉后自动注销,想当于浏览器申请使用内存,这样的大部分的数据可以合理利用,增加客户端的响应速度。服务端SESSION少量建议使用能提高效率,更多可以使用会占内存
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。